In an interview with Gazeta Wyborcza, Reza Moghadam, director of the IMF´s European Department, says that the weakness of the CESEE region is not only cyclical.

According to Moghadam, the CESEE region is confronted with a number of unsolved issues. After a period of rapid growth rates, the economy deteriorated substantially after 2008. This was mainly due to the stop of capital inflows and the collapse in global trade, Moghadam told Gazeta Wyborcza.
After another slowdown in 2012/13, the CESEE economy is recovering slowly, Moghadam says.…
